## Changelog — Gustline v2.3

Renamed `FANOUT_PUSH_TOKEN` to `FANOUT_RELAY_SECRET` for the weather-alert fan-out worker. The old name is no longer read as of this release, so contractors updating older deployments must migrate their env files by hand. Remove the deprecated entry entirely, then add the replacement line shown here:

env line for yahip-tafog: RELAY_SECRET3=4ca

As part of migrating off the homegrown Taskwright queue to the managed Quillstack broker, the Ferrowave platform team retired the old dispatcher credentials. For audit purposes, note that legacy jobs can still be drained from the archive node, but doing so requires elevated recovery access rather than standard operator roles. The drain tool validates operator identity, then requires manual entry of the recovery passphrase before it will touch archived payloads. That passphrase is recorded below for reviewer verification:

recovery phrase for fajeg-hagug: holox-fenmir

## Runbook: Orchidbeam firmware channel switch

If a customer's Orchidbeam hub is stuck on the beta firmware channel, don't reset the device — that wipes their pairing data and they will be unhappy. Instead, move them back to stable via the fleet console and push a channel refresh. Takes about five minutes. The channel service should be running with these values:

config for tagep-yajef:
ulawyn:
  log_level: error
  metrics_host: metrics.ulawyn.lumiclabs.internal
  pin: 0564
  pool_size: 32